Bill Posted May 7, 2023 Author Report Share Posted May 7, 2023 Got a bit of a queue next week with people wanting to try out my car so fingers crossed I’ll soon have a bit more space in the garage. In the four and a half years I’ve had the car, it’s only been treated to the odd hand car wash, and I’ve never bothered waxing or polishing it. So, I spent a few days preparing and detailing the car to try and get it into showroom condition but the glossier I got the thing, the more the minor stone chips seemed to show. ☹ Me being me, I think I’m a honest person and hate to think I’d ever sell something only to find the buyer is disappointed if they ever discover something wrong that I didn’t know about, so at the last service, I paid for a full inspection to identify any potential issues. It turned out there were some that weren’t serious but ideally needed attention, so I had these fixed at quite some expense. So, having done my best, it came as a bit of a shock when one prospective buyer suggested I was massively overcharging as he’d done an online check on the car, and it came back with a valuation 12K below my asking price. This got me worried, and I began to wonder if the car had some hidden history that I was unaware of, as that would affect the valuation. So, I paid a tenner to the same online checking company and thank God, it came back perfectly clear of issues and with a valuation close to mine; Phew! Having written this guy off as a chancer or tyre kicker, it was nice to receive an email from him, profusely apologising for his mistake having entered the wrong registration. Now he’s keen enough to travel all the way down from Glasgow to just view the car. The day after that, I’ve got someone driving up from Essex, and later today there’s a guy from Leigh wanting to try it. Fingers crossed!
